Investigation of inelastic scattering of α-particles by 16O with αγ-angular correlation

The results of measurements of double differential cross sections of the 16O(α, αγ)16O reaction at Eα=25.2 MeV and 30.3 MeV for scattering angles from 18 to 162 deg are presented. The modelless restoration of all even spin-tensor components of the density matrix of the 3-(6.131 MeV) state and of its most part for the 2+(6.916 MeV) state of residual nucleus is carried out. The angular dependences of differential cross section of the same reaction with 16O nucleus low states excitation and excitation functions for three scattering angles 38, 138 and 162 deg in energy interval 21-30 MeV are measured. the experimental results are compared with calculations incorporating the collective excitation mechanism by coupled-channel method and the compound nucleus production mechanism. 14 refs., 6 figs., 1 tab
